I didn't think you were allowed to wear race numbers on the road? Or is that an urban myth?

MSA license holder must have a black tape over the number or removed it, proir on the public road. MSA is a motorsport association with FIA and not a boy racer club.

As above, as a member of the Motorsport Association you cannot use numbers on the public roads. Putting black tape across number is insufficient, the number must not be visible.

For each event you are allocated a new number. It may differ each time.
